The gross margin is the variety of whole gross sales revenue after accounting for all the costs needed to provide your goods or providers . The gross margin is calculated by subtracting COGS from income, and then dividing this quantity by the revenue. “Bookkeeping” refers to sustaining common records of a business’s monetary moves and acquiring essential information that may later be used for tax or reporting purposes. In most companies, the accounting course of begins with what’s known as a general ledger. This doc serves to offer a single source where all of a business’s financial transactions are tracked in shut element. It is crucial that whoever controls a business’s common ledger takes time to import all info precisely to keep away from additional issues when it comes time to file taxes. Many applications exist to help business homeowners manage and observe their monetary transactions, though some small business house owners prefer to record their transactions by hand or in any other case without the help of these programs.

A bachelor’s degree in finance, accounting, economics, or business administration is the minimum tutorial preparation for monetary managers. However, many employers now seek graduates with a master’s degree, ideally in business administration, finance, or economics. These tutorial programs develop analytical expertise and train financial evaluation strategies and know-how.
